¿Tu sitio WordPress muestra una advertencia "No seguro"? ¿Ves esta advertencia en varias páginas de tu sitio? Este problema común pero serio puede ahuyentar a los visitantes y perjudicar el posicionamiento de tu sitio en los motores de búsqueda. Entonces, ¿cómo puedes solucionar esto y asegurar tu sitio?
La solución es sencilla. Necesitas configurar un certificado SSL para tu sitio. Esto puede significar instalar uno nuevo, corregir la configuración de tu certificado actual o renovarlo si ha expirado. Si esto suena confuso, no te preocupes.
En este artículo, te guiaremos a través de los pasos para eliminar la advertencia "No seguro" de tu sitio WordPress.
¿Qué significa la advertencia "Sitio no seguro" en WordPress?
Un sitio WordPress generalmente muestra una advertencia "No seguro" porque carece de un certificado SSL/TLS válido, que asegura la conexión entre el servidor y el navegador del usuario. Esto puede ocurrir si el certificado ha expirado, está mal configurado o no existe. Sin él, la URL del sitio no tendrá la "S" en "HTTPS", lo que hace que los navegadores la marquen como "No segura".
Otra razón para esta advertencia es el contenido mixto. Esto ocurre cuando un sitio usa HTTPS, pero algunos elementos, como imágenes o scripts, todavía se cargan a través de HTTP. Esto sucede a menudo cuando los archivos multimedia o los plugins enlazan a URLs inseguras.
Solucionar las advertencias "No seguro" es crucial. Google valora los sitios web seguros y usa HTTPS como factor de posicionamiento. Un sitio no seguro pone en riesgo los datos de los usuarios y puede dañar tu SEO.
¿Qué causa un error de conexión segura en WordPress?
Certificado SSL expirado – Si tu certificado SSL ha expirado, causará un error de conexión segura.
Certificado SSL mal configurado – Si el certificado SSL no está instalado correctamente, puede impedir establecer una conexión segura.
Problemas de contenido mixto – El contenido mixto (HTTPS y HTTP) provoca un error de conexión segura.
Dirección incorrecta de WordPress o dirección del sitio – Si las configuraciones de "Dirección de WordPress (URL)" o "Dirección del sitio (URL)" en tu panel de WordPress están equivocadas, la conexión segura puede fallar.
Carga del servidor o tiempo de inactividad – La carga pesada del servidor o el tiempo de inactividad pueden provocar problemas temporales de conexión.
Nota: Es una buena idea hacer una copia de seguridad de tu sitio web antes de hacer cualquier cambio. Puedes restaurar rápidamente tu sitio a su estado anterior si algo sale mal*. Puedes usar WP Staging para copias de seguridad automáticas y fáciles. Consulta la guía de copia de seguridad y restauración para más ayuda.*
Recargar la página
Recargar la página a veces puede resolver el error HTTP 501 Not Implemented en WordPress, principalmente si lo causan fallos temporales del servidor o datos de caché obsoletos.
Al realizar una simple recarga o una recarga forzada (usando Ctrl + Shift + R en Windows o Comando + Shift + R en macOS), puedes asegurarte de que tu navegador obtenga los datos más recientes del servidor.
Este método es rápido, fácil y a menudo efectivo, lo que lo convierte en un primer paso importante en la solución de problemas antes de pasar a soluciones más complejas.
Verificar el certificado SSL
Verificar el certificado SSL es esencial para diagnosticar y resolver problemas de conexión segura en WordPress.
Aquí hay una guía paso a paso sobre cómo hacerlo:
- Abre tu navegador web y navega a tu sitio WordPress ingresando la URL (por ejemplo, https://www.example.com).

- Comprueba la barra de direcciones para ver un ícono de candado junto a la URL; si está presente y verde o con otros indicadores seguros, el certificado SSL es válido y se ha establecido una conexión segura.

- Haz clic en el ícono de candado o en la etiqueta "Seguro" en la barra de direcciones. Esta acción mostrará más detalles sobre el certificado SSL y la conexión segura.

- Ahora, haz clic en el certificado válido.

- En los detalles del certificado, verifica el emisor, el período de validez y las claves criptográficas utilizadas para el cifrado. Asegúrate de que esté emitido por una autoridad confiable y no haya expirado.

- Verifica el "Válido desde" del certificado en el pasado y el "Válido hasta" en el futuro; un certificado expirado bloquea una conexión segura.

Siguiendo estos pasos, puedes verificar el certificado SSL de tu sitio WordPress y asegurarte de que es válido y está correctamente configurado, proporcionando una experiencia de navegación segura y confiable para tus visitantes.
Ejecutar una prueba de servidor SSL
Ejecutar una prueba de servidor SSL puede ayudar a diagnosticar problemas con el certificado SSL de un sitio web que podrían estar causando el error "Your Connection Is Not Private". Aquí está cómo hacerlo:
Ve a una herramienta confiable de prueba SSL como SSL Test de SSL Labs (https://www.ssllabs.com/ssltest/). En el campo proporcionado, ingresa la URL del sitio web que experimenta el error y haz clic en el botón de envío.

Revisa los resultados de la prueba para verificar fechas de expiración, problemas de cadena de certificados o vulnerabilidades de seguridad. Informa al administrador del sitio web de cualquier problema y evita usar el sitio hasta que se resuelvan.
Verificar la configuración SSL en WordPress
Verificar la configuración SSL en WordPress implica comprobar y asegurarse de que el sitio web esté configurado correctamente para usar URLs HTTPS (seguras) para todo su contenido y comunicaciones.
Aquí hay una explicación de los pasos involucrados:
- Inicia sesión en el área de administración de WordPress ingresando tu nombre de usuario y contraseña.

- Una vez iniciada la sesión, haz clic en "Ajustes" en el menú izquierdo y selecciona "Generales" en el submenú.

- En Ajustes Generales, verifica "Dirección de WordPress (URL)" y "Dirección del sitio (URL)". Comienza ambas URLs con "https://" en lugar de "http://" y actualiza si es necesario.

- Si necesitas cambiar las URLs para usar HTTPS, modifica las URLs en los campos respectivos y luego haz clic en el botón "Guardar cambios" en la parte inferior de la página.

Siguiendo estos pasos, puedes verificar y configurar los ajustes SSL en WordPress, asegurando que tu sitio web utilice HTTPS de forma segura y proporcione una experiencia de navegación segura para tus visitantes.
Resolver manualmente el problema de contenido mixto
- Accede a tu panel de WordPress.

- Navega a Ajustes » Generales y asegúrate de que tanto las opciones ‘Dirección de WordPress’ como ‘Dirección del sitio’ contengan URLs HTTPS.

- Cuando encuentres URLs ‘http’, cámbialas a ‘https’ y haz clic en ‘Guardar cambios’ para guardar tu configuración.

Después, localiza las URLs HTTP obsoletas en tu base de datos de WordPress y sustitúyelas por las URLs HTTPS actualizadas. Instala y activa el plugin Better Search Replace para hacerlo sin esfuerzo.
Una vez activado, navega a la página Herramientas » Better Search Replace. En el campo ‘Search’, ingresa la URL de tu sitio web con HTTP, y en el campo ‘Replace’, ingresa la URL de tu sitio web con ‘https’.

El plugin procederá a modificar las URLs dentro de tu base de datos de WordPress.
Sigue estos pasos para corregir errores de contenido mixto, mejorar la seguridad de tu sitio WordPress y evitar las advertencias de seguridad del navegador. Mantén HTTPS para una experiencia segura de los visitantes.
Verificar la compatibilidad con el protocolo TLS/SSL
La advertencia "No seguro" puede ocurrir si tu navegador o servidor usa protocolos TLS/SSL incorrectos. TLS, la versión actualizada de SSL, asegura las conexiones. Aquí está cómo verificar y habilitar los protocolos correctos:
La mayoría de los navegadores modernos admiten automáticamente los últimos protocolos TLS. Sin embargo, si usas un navegador antiguo, es posible que necesites habilitarlos manualmente.
Escribe "about:config" en la barra de direcciones del navegador, busca "security.tls.version.min" y asegúrate de que el valor esté establecido en 3 (que corresponde a TLS 1.2).

Si administras tu servidor, asegúrate de que admita los últimos protocolos TLS en la configuración SSL/TLS. Pide a tu proveedor de hosting que verifique y habilite los protocolos correctos si no estás seguro.
Desactivar las extensiones del navegador
A veces, la advertencia "No seguro" se activa por extensiones del navegador que interfieren con las conexiones seguras, especialmente las relacionadas con la seguridad o la privacidad. Aquí está cómo verificar si las extensiones están causando el problema:
Ve a la configuración de tu navegador y navega a la sección de extensiones o complementos.

Desactiva temporalmente todas las extensiones desactivándolas.

Después de desactivar las extensiones, comprueba el sitio web. Si el error ha desaparecido, vuelve a activar las extensiones una por una, probando después de cada una para identificar cuál extensión está causando el problema.
Al desactivar y reactivar selectivamente las extensiones de tu navegador, puedes determinar si una de ellas está causando la advertencia "No seguro" y solucionar el problema.
Conclusión
Al añadir un certificado SSL a tu sitio WordPress, has dado un gran paso hacia su protección. Pero esto es solo el comienzo.
Toma estos pasos adicionales para mantener tu sitio seguro y funcionando sin problemas.
Artículos relacionados
- ¿Cómo solucionar el error 429 Too Many Requests en WordPress?
- Cómo solucionar el error HTTP durante la carga de imágenes en WordPress
- ¿Cómo solucionar el error "Sorry, You Are Not Allowed to Access This Page" en WordPress?
- ¿Cómo solucionar los problemas de actualización y redirección de la página de inicio de sesión de WordPress?
- Reducir las solicitudes HTTP para un sitio WordPress